Dragons start off season with team, individual win at Wray Invite

It took a while, but golf season has started for the Holyoke girls golf team.

And what a start it was.

The Dragons won the team title at the Wray Invite, behind a first-place finish by senior Emma Thompson.

Holyoke finished seven strokes ahead of the hosts, 301-308. Third place Limon was 17 strokes back.

Thompson had a personal best score of 77 and needed every stroke she could get to hold off Akron’s Kendall Velder’s 80.

Head Coach Nick Flaa was enthusiastic about Thompson’s day.

“Emma is hitting the ball hard off of the tee box and was able to play with some great finesse around the greens. Her wedge play and putting today may have been the best I’ve seen from her to date,” Flaa said, adding that a couple approach shots with her iron play and a few more accurate ones off the tee would have had Thompson flirting with the Par 70 course quite easily. 

Senior Erin Andersen finished the day in 10th place with a score of 106. Andersen shot 57 over her first nine holes and knocked off eight strokes her second time through. 

In their first varsity competition, senior Jimena Nuñez and junior Megan Walker each shot 118 to finish at the middle of the pack. Walker finished with the second nine holes well, lowering her score by four strokes compared to the first nine holes.

Flaa said it was an obviously a strong showing from Thompson, but the Dragons also great contributions from Andersen, Nuñez and Walker.

“You couldn’t draw up a better start,” Flaa said.

Flaa complimented the four freshmen who were JV for their first high school tournament.

Emma Henry, Rozlynn Crossland, Roslynne Doorn and Gracelyn Bahnsen had an awesome day, Flaa said, adding it was good for them to see how a tournament works and to get those jitters out of the way.
